Kendall Andrew Grose, a physician specializing in Pain Management, and Physical Medicine and Rehabilitation, completed an Internship with Michigan State University at the world renowned Henry Ford Hospital. Dr. Grose later completed a residency in Physical Medicine and Rehabilitation with Wayne State University at the Detroit Medical Center where he served as Chief Resident. He continued on to complete a fellowship in the department of Anesthesia in Pain Medicine at the Detroit Medical Center.

He is a member of the American Academy of Pain Medicine, American Academy of Physical Medicine and Rehabilitation, American Medical Society for Sports Medicine, and National Athletic Trainers Association.
